中芯国际(688981) - 2024Q1投资者关系活动记录表
688981SMIC(688981)2024-05-13 07:37

Group 1: Company Overview - Semiconductor Manufacturing International Corporation (SMIC) is a leading integrated circuit foundry in China, providing 8-inch and 12-inch wafer foundry and technology services globally [3] - The company has manufacturing and service bases in Shanghai, Beijing, Tianjin, and Shenzhen, with marketing offices in the US, Europe, Japan, and Taiwan [3] Group 2: Q1 2024 Financial Performance - Q1 2024 unaudited revenue was 1.75billion,aquarteronquarterincreaseof4.31.75 billion, a quarter-on-quarter increase of 4.3% [4] - Gross margin was 13.7%, down 2.7 percentage points from the previous quarter [4] - Operating profit was 2.41 million, with EBITDA of 887millionandanEBITDAmarginof50.7887 million and an EBITDA margin of 50.7% [4] - Total assets at the end of Q1 were 48.2 billion, with total liabilities of 17.3billion,includinginterestbearingdebtof17.3 billion, including interest-bearing debt of 10.3 billion [4] - Total equity stood at 30.8billion,withadebttoequityratioof33.530.8 billion, with a debt-to-equity ratio of 33.5% and a net debt-to-equity ratio of -16.4% [4] Group 3: Q2 2024 Guidance - Q2 2024 revenue is expected to grow by 5% to 7% quarter-on-quarter, with gross margin projected between 9% and 11% [4] - The company anticipates a significant increase in revenue for the first half of 2024 compared to the same period last year [5] Group 4: Market Dynamics and Strategy - The integrated circuit industry is recovering, with improved customer inventory levels and increased demand for consumer electronics [5] - The company is prioritizing capital expenditure on capacity expansion and R&D to enhance core competitiveness and shareholder value [4][5] - SMIC plans not to distribute profits for the fiscal year 2023, aligning with long-term development needs and shareholder interests [4] Group 5: Product and Revenue Breakdown - In Q1 2024, the company shipped 1.79 million 8-inch equivalent wafers, a 7% increase quarter-on-quarter [5] - Revenue by region: China (82%), USA (15%), and Eurasia (3%) [5] - Revenue by service type: wafer revenue (93%) and other revenue (7%) [5] - Revenue by application: smartphones (31%), computers and tablets (18%), consumer electronics (31%), IoT and automotive (13%), and others (7%) [5] Group 6: Future Outlook - The global semiconductor market is projected to reach 1 trillion by 2030, driven by new market demands and increased silicon content in electronic products [6] - The company plans to maintain a capital expenditure of approximately $7.5 billion for the year, focusing on equipment spending [8]
